What parents usually want from car seat strap covers

Most parents searching for car seat strap covers are trying to solve a very specific comfort problem: straps that rub the neck or face, covers that have become dirty or worn, or a need for more padding during daily rides. The best infant car seat strap covers and baby car seat strap covers are soft against the skin, easy to keep clean, and shaped to sit comfortably on the harness without adding unnecessary bulk. If you’re comparing padded car seat strap covers, washable options, or universal car seat strap covers, it helps to focus on your child’s age, how often the seat is used, and whether your priority is softness, replacement, or easier cleanup.

How to choose car seat shoulder strap covers with confidence

Prioritize softness where straps touch skin

If your child gets red marks or seems bothered by the harness, look for soft car seat strap covers with a smooth surface and gentle padding where the straps rest near the neck and shoulders.

Think about cleanup before you buy

Washable car seat strap covers can make everyday messes much easier to manage. If snacks, spit-up, sunscreen, or summer sweat are common, removable and easy-care materials are often worth it.

Check fit and compatibility carefully

Universal car seat strap covers can be convenient, but size and shape still matter. Covers should sit neatly on the harness and feel comfortable without shifting around during regular use.

Common reasons parents replace car seat strap pads

The original covers are missing

It’s common for car seat strap pads to get misplaced during cleaning, travel, or hand-me-down transitions. Many parents simply need a practical replacement that restores comfort.

The current covers feel rough or flat

Over time, baby car seat strap covers can lose softness or padding. Replacing them can help make rides feel gentler, especially for younger babies and frequent travelers.

You want a cleaner, easier-care option

If the current covers stain easily or are hard to wash, switching to washable car seat strap covers can make routine maintenance much simpler.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are car seat strap covers used for?

Car seat strap covers are designed to add softness where the harness touches a child’s neck and shoulders. Parents often choose them to improve comfort, replace missing pads, or make cleanup easier.

Are infant car seat strap covers different from other strap covers?

Infant car seat strap covers are often chosen with extra attention to softness, size, and gentle contact against delicate skin. When comparing options, parents usually look for a comfortable fit and materials that feel smooth during everyday rides.

What should I look for in washable car seat strap covers?

Look for materials that are easy to remove, simple to clean, and comfortable after repeated washing. Many parents prefer washable covers that stay soft and hold their shape over time.

Do universal car seat strap covers fit every seat the same way?

Universal car seat strap covers are made to work across many models, but fit can still vary. It helps to compare dimensions, closure style, and overall shape so the covers sit neatly and comfortably on the harness.

When do parents usually replace car seat shoulder strap covers?

Parents often replace car seat shoulder strap covers when the originals are missing, stained, flattened, rough, or no longer feel comfortable for their child during rides.
